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a novel vertical frame replacement method and a novel vertical frame replacement tool of a balance weight without losing workability.SOLUTION: A vertical frame replacement method of a balance weight including a pair of left and right vertical frames, an upper beam for connecting the vertical frames on an upper side, a lower frame for connecting the vertical frames on a lower side, and a laminate weight stored in a space including the vertical frames, the upper beam and the lower beam includes the step (S1) of lowering the balance weight to the pit of a hoistway to come into contact with a buffer installed on the pit, the step (S3) of fitting a weight presser between a fitting plate provided on the upper beam and a fixing tool provided in the bottom surface of the balance weight, the step of releasing the connection of the upper beam, the lower beam, and the left and right vertical frames to remove the vertical frames, the step (S5) of connecting prepared replacement vertical frames to the upper beam and the lower beam, and the step (S9) of removing the weight presser.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 3

本発明の実施形態は、つり合い重りの縦枠交換方法及び縦枠交換用治具に関する。   Embodiments described herein relate generally to a counterweight replacement method and a vertical frame replacement jig for a counterweight.

リニューアル時の重り枠において、耐震基準が見直された場合、強度基準を満足できない場合がある。また、リニューアル後にかご重量が増加した場合、既存の重り枠では高さ寸法が足りず、重りの積み増しができない場合がある。これらのことから、現状におけるリニューアル時は重り枠を全て交換していた。   In the weight frame at the time of renewal, when the seismic standards are reviewed, the strength standards may not be satisfied. In addition, when the car weight increases after renewal, the existing weight frame may not have enough height, and the weights may not be stacked. For these reasons, all the weight frames were exchanged during the current renewal.

特開2011−79615号公報JP 2011-79615 A

しかしながら、重り枠の交換作業では、縦枠の強度が問題となる。また、重り枠を全て交換するには、既存重りを全て降ろす作業が必要となり、作業性が悪いという課題があった。   However, the strength of the vertical frame becomes a problem in the weight frame replacement operation. Further, in order to replace all the weight frames, it is necessary to remove all the existing weights, which causes a problem that workability is poor.

本発明の実施形態は、作業性を損なうことなく新規なつり合い重りの縦枠交換方法及び縦枠交換用治具を提供することを目的とする。   An object of the present invention is to provide a new vertical frame replacement method for a counterweight and a vertical frame replacement jig without impairing workability.

本発明は、重り枠の交換作業の省力化を目指しており、重り枠の交換部品を強度面で問題となることが多い縦枠に絞った構造を提案する。また、重り枠を全て交換するときに作業として発生する既存重りの全降ろし作業を省略できるようにすることで、作業時間の短縮と、安全性の向上を目的としている。   The present invention aims to save labor in replacing the weight frame, and proposes a structure in which the weight frame replacement part is narrowed down to the vertical frame, which is often problematic in terms of strength. Further, the present invention aims to shorten the work time and improve the safety by making it possible to omit the entire unloading work of the existing weight that is generated as a work when replacing all the weight frames.

<Embodiment 1>
1A and 1B show Embodiment 1 of a vertical frame exchanging method and a vertical frame exchanging jig for a counterweight, wherein FIG. 1A is a plan view and FIG. 1B is a side view. FIG. 2 is a cross-sectional view taken along line AA in FIG.

各図に示すつり合い重り1は、ロープ3によって乗りかご(図示せず)と連結されており、乗りかごの移動に伴い、ガイドレール5L,5Rに沿って上下方向に移動可能に設けられている。   The counterweight 1 shown in each figure is connected to a car (not shown) by a rope 3 and is provided so as to be movable in the vertical direction along the guide rails 5L and 5R as the car moves. .

つり合い重り1は、重り枠7と、この重り枠7内に積層される積層重り10とを備えている。重り枠7は、水平断面がコの字状に形成された左右一対の縦枠9L,9Rと、縦枠9L,9R同士を上方で連結する上梁11と、縦枠9L,9R同士を下方で連結する下梁13とを備えている。縦枠9L,9Rの上端及び下端には、それぞれレールガイド15L,15R及び17L,17Rが設けられ、つり合い重り1をガイドレール5L,5Rに沿って上下方向に案内する。なお、図1は、上方のレールガイド15L,15Rが取り外された状態を示している。   The counterweight 1 includes a weight frame 7 and a stacked weight 10 stacked in the weight frame 7. The weight frame 7 includes a pair of left and right vertical frames 9L and 9R having a horizontal cross section formed in a U-shape, an upper beam 11 that connects the vertical frames 9L and 9R upward, and the vertical frames 9L and 9R downward. And a lower beam 13 connected to each other. Rail guides 15L, 15R and 17L, 17R are provided at the upper and lower ends of the vertical frames 9L, 9R, respectively, and guide the counterweight 1 in the vertical direction along the guide rails 5L, 5R. FIG. 1 shows a state in which the upper rail guides 15L and 15R are removed.

縦枠9L,9Rには重り挿入口19L,19Rが形成されており、この重り挿入口19L,19Rから積層重り10の出し入れがされる。   Weight insertion ports 19L and 19R are formed in the vertical frames 9L and 9R, and the stacking weight 10 is taken in and out from the weight insertion ports 19L and 19R.

昇降路のピット21には、つり合い重り1が所定の位置より低下した場合に受け止める緩衝機能を有する緩衝器23が設置されている。   In the pit 21 of the hoistway, a shock absorber 23 having a shock absorbing function for receiving when the counterweight 1 is lowered from a predetermined position is installed.

本発明の実施形態では、この緩衝器23を利用した縦枠9L,9Rの交換方法を提供する。その際に、積層重り10の落下を防止するために、重り押さえ25L,25Rを上梁11から下梁13までの間に取り付けるようにしている。すなわち、レールガイド15L,15Rを取り外した後のレールガイド取付板14L,14Rと、つり合い重り1の底面側に設けられる重り押さえ取付板27L,27Rとの間に重り押さえ25L,25Rを取り付けるようにしている。   In the embodiment of the present invention, a method of exchanging the vertical frames 9L and 9R using the shock absorber 23 is provided. At that time, in order to prevent the stacked weight 10 from falling, the weight retainers 25L and 25R are attached between the upper beam 11 and the lower beam 13. That is, the weight retainers 25L, 25R are attached between the rail guide attachment plates 14L, 14R after the rail guides 15L, 15R are removed and the weight retainer attachment plates 27L, 27R provided on the bottom surface side of the counterweight 1. ing.

重り押さえ取付板27L,27Rについて説明する。ロープ3は、時間が経過するに連れて伸びが生じるため、つり合い重り1と緩衝器23との間のカウンタクリアランスが小さくなる。そこで、つり合い重り1の底面には金属製のスペーサ取付板29が設けられており、このスペーサ取付板29に木製のスペーサをボルトによって取り付け、ロープ3が伸びてきたときには、板厚を変更したり、スペーサ自体を取り外したりして一定の間隙を確保するようにしている。   The weight holding attachment plates 27L and 27R will be described. Since the rope 3 grows with time, the counter clearance between the counterweight 1 and the shock absorber 23 becomes small. Therefore, a metal spacer mounting plate 29 is provided on the bottom surface of the counterweight 1, and a wooden spacer is mounted on the spacer mounting plate 29 with bolts. When the rope 3 is extended, the plate thickness is changed. The spacer itself is removed to ensure a certain gap.

本実施形態では、スペーサを取り除いた後のスペーサ取付板29に重り押さえ取付板27L,27Rが取り付けられる。図2に示すように、この重り押さえ取付板27L,27Rは、矩形状の厚さ数ミリ程度の金属板であり、先端部が下梁13よりも前方側に突出するように取り付けられており、先端部には、ボルト28を取り付けためのボルト穴が設けられている。   In this embodiment, the weight presser mounting plates 27L and 27R are attached to the spacer mounting plate 29 after the spacer is removed. As shown in FIG. 2, the weight presser mounting plates 27 </ b> L and 27 </ b> R are rectangular metal plates having a thickness of about several millimeters, and are attached so that the tip portion projects forward from the lower beam 13. A bolt hole for attaching the bolt 28 is provided at the tip.

<Vertical frame replacement procedure>
Next, the procedure for replacing the vertical frame will be described with reference to FIG.

図3に示すように、まず、つり合い重り1を昇降路の底面を構成するピット21まで降下させ、ピット21内に設けられている緩衝器23上に載置させる(ステップS1)。   As shown in FIG. 3, first, the counterweight 1 is lowered to the pit 21 constituting the bottom surface of the hoistway, and placed on the shock absorber 23 provided in the pit 21 (step S1).

次に、上梁11の上側に取り付けられている左右のレールガイド15L,15Rを取り外す。左右のレールガイド15L,15Rは、レールガイド取付板14L,14R上にネジ止めされているので、このネジをゆるめて取り外す。図1は、左右のレールガイド15L,15Rが取り外された状態を示している。また、つり合い重り1の底面に重り押さえ取付板27L,27Rを取り付ける(ステップS3)。   Next, the left and right rail guides 15L and 15R attached to the upper side of the upper beam 11 are removed. Since the left and right rail guides 15L and 15R are screwed onto the rail guide mounting plates 14L and 14R, the screws are loosened and removed. FIG. 1 shows a state in which the left and right rail guides 15L and 15R are removed. Further, the weight holding attachment plates 27L and 27R are attached to the bottom surface of the counterweight 1 (step S3).

次に、重り押さえ25L,25Rを上梁11から下梁13までの間に取り付ける(ステップS5)。まず、レールガイド15L,15Rを取り外した後のレールガイド取付板14L,14Rのネジ穴を利用してネジ止めし、また、つり合い重り1の底面側に設けられる重り押さえ取付板27L,27Rのネジ穴を利用して重り押さえ25L,25Rをボルト28によって締結する。   Next, the weight retainers 25L and 25R are attached between the upper beam 11 and the lower beam 13 (step S5). First, using the screw holes of the rail guide mounting plates 14L and 14R after the rail guides 15L and 15R are removed, the screws are fixed to the weight holding mounting plates 27L and 27R provided on the bottom side of the counterweight 1. The weight retainers 25L and 25R are fastened by bolts 28 using the holes.

このようにして、積層重り10のずれや落下が防止されると、上梁11及び下梁13と縦枠9L,9Rのボルト締め部分を取り外し、縦枠9L,9Rを取り除く。このとき、上梁11は、ロープ3につり下げられた状態である。古い縦枠9L,9Rが取り外されると、新しい縦枠9L,9Rを上梁11及び下梁13に取り付ける(ステップS7)。   In this manner, when the stacking weight 10 is prevented from being displaced or dropped, the upper beam 11 and the lower beam 13 and the bolted portions of the vertical frames 9L and 9R are removed, and the vertical frames 9L and 9R are removed. At this time, the upper beam 11 is suspended from the rope 3. When the old vertical frames 9L and 9R are removed, the new vertical frames 9L and 9R are attached to the upper beam 11 and the lower beam 13 (step S7).

縦枠9L,9Rの交換が完了すると、重り押さえ取付板27L,27Rのボルト28を緩めるとともに、レールガイド取付板14L,14Rのボルトを緩めて、重り押さえ27L,27Rを取り外す(ステップS9)。最後に、レールガイド取付板14L,14Rにレールガイド15L,15Rを取り付ける(ステップS11)。   When the replacement of the vertical frames 9L, 9R is completed, the bolts 28 of the weight presser mounting plates 27L, 27R are loosened, and the bolts of the rail guide mounting plates 14L, 14R are loosened to remove the weight pressers 27L, 27R (step S9). Finally, the rail guides 15L and 15R are attached to the rail guide attachment plates 14L and 14R (step S11).

このように、実施形態1によれば、レールガイド取付板14L,14R、重り押さえ取付板27L,27R及び重り押さえ25L,25Rを利用することによって、簡単な作業により縦枠9L,9Rの交換が可能になる。また、重りおさえ25L,25Rにより、積層重り10の飛び出しや脱落が防止されると共に、縦枠撤去後のつり合い重り1の水平方向への移動を制限することが可能になる。   As described above, according to the first embodiment, by using the rail guide mounting plates 14L and 14R, the weight presser mounting plates 27L and 27R, and the weight pressers 25L and 25R, the vertical frames 9L and 9R can be easily replaced. It becomes possible. Further, the weight holders 25L and 25R can prevent the stacked weight 10 from popping out and falling off, and can restrict the movement of the counterweight 1 in the horizontal direction after the vertical frame is removed.

<Embodiment 2>
4A and 4B show a second embodiment of a vertical frame replacement method and a vertical frame replacement jig for a counterweight, wherein FIG. 4A is a plan view and FIG. 4B is a side view. FIG. 5 is a cross-sectional view taken along line BB in FIG. In each figure, the same components as those in the first embodiment are denoted by the same reference numerals, and the description thereof is omitted. Only differences from the first embodiment will be described.

実施形態1では、縦枠9L,9Rを取り外した後の上梁11はロープ3でつり下げられた状態であった。実施形態2では、上梁11に重り枠上梁支え31L,31Rを設け、上梁11が揺れないようにガイドレール5L,5Rに固定することで、上梁11の水平面内での移動を抑制するようにしている。   In the first embodiment, the upper beam 11 after the vertical frames 9L and 9R are removed is suspended by the rope 3. In the second embodiment, the upper beam 11 is provided with weight frame upper beam supports 31L and 31R, and is fixed to the guide rails 5L and 5R so that the upper beam 11 does not shake, thereby suppressing the movement of the upper beam 11 in the horizontal plane. Like to do.

重り枠上梁支え31L,31Rは、図5に示すように、垂直側面32aとこの垂直側面32aの両端から延出されて相対向する対向面32b,32bとから水平断面がコ字状(U字状)に形成されている。   As shown in FIG. 5, the weight frame upper beam supports 31L and 31R have a U-shaped horizontal cross section from a vertical side surface 32a and opposing surfaces 32b and 32b extending from both ends of the vertical side surface 32a and facing each other (U It is formed in a letter shape.

そして、縦枠の交換作業においては、図3のステップS3において、上梁11の上側に取り付けられている左右のレールガイド15L,15Rを取り外した後、垂直側面32aをガイドレール5L,5Rの裏側に位置させてレールクリップ33でガイドレール5L,5Rと共にレールブラケット4L,4Rに取り付ける。また、対向面32b,32bを、ボルト34によって、上梁11に固定する。このステップS3における重り枠上梁支え31L,31Rの取り付け作業以外は、実施形態1と同じ工程で交換作業が行われる。交換作業が終了すると、重り枠上梁支え31L,31Rはガイドレール5L,5Rから取り外される。   In the replacement operation of the vertical frame, in step S3 of FIG. 3, after removing the left and right rail guides 15L and 15R attached to the upper side of the upper beam 11, the vertical side surface 32a is placed behind the guide rails 5L and 5R. The rail clip 33 is attached to the rail brackets 4L and 4R together with the guide rails 5L and 5R. Further, the facing surfaces 32 b and 32 b are fixed to the upper beam 11 by bolts 34. Except for the work of attaching the beam support 31L, 31R on the weight frame in step S3, the replacement work is performed in the same process as in the first embodiment. When the replacement work is completed, the weight frame upper beam supports 31L and 31R are removed from the guide rails 5L and 5R.

このように実施形態2によれば、上梁11を単にロープ3でつり下げるだけでなく、重り枠上梁支え31L,31Rで上梁11が揺れないようにガイドレール5L,5Rに固定するので、重り枠7全体が揺れたり、倒れたりするのを防止でき、縦枠9L,9Rの交換作業を迅速かつ効率よく行うことができる。   As described above, according to the second embodiment, the upper beam 11 is not simply suspended by the rope 3, but is fixed to the guide rails 5L and 5R so that the upper beam 11 is not shaken by the weight beam upper beam supports 31L and 31R. The entire weight frame 7 can be prevented from shaking or falling down, and the replacement work of the vertical frames 9L and 9R can be performed quickly and efficiently.

以上の各実施形態によれば、つり合い重りを構成する部品中、使用できる部品を残したままで縦枠のみの交換を簡単な作業で行うことができる。交換作業においては、積層重りの降ろし作業を省略することができるため、工事期間の短縮が可能となり、また、積み下ろし作業を最低限に抑制することができるので、作業性が向上する。   According to each of the embodiments described above, it is possible to exchange only the vertical frame with a simple operation while leaving usable parts among the parts constituting the counterweight. In the replacement operation, the stacking weight unloading operation can be omitted, so that the construction period can be shortened and the unloading operation can be suppressed to a minimum, so that workability is improved.
